John Deere 850 W/model 80 loader is slow ,to me anyway. I am used to bigger machines FEL speeds. It states in the manual a speed of 4-5 seconds to go from ground to full height. best time so far 7 seconds,dump on bucket even slower, cleaned inner screen,replaced external filter. Air temp is in the low 30's, machine is warmed up.The FEL is run from the same pump that runs the rear pto lift and the power steering. So here is my question, is this the best I can expect without mounting a pump on the front of the engine for the FEL? and is it possible? If so can I use the the same fluid?
